HINKLE v. HINKLE

No. 70456.

945 S.W.2d 43 (1997)

Arnold D. HINKLE, Petitioner/Appellant, v. Annette M. HINKLE, Respondent/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Eastern District, Division Three.

April 29, 1997.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Nadine V. Nunn, St. Louis, for petitioner/appellant.

David S. Fischer, St. Louis, for respondent/respondent.

Before CRAHAN, P.J., and GRIMM and HOFF, JJ.


ORDER

PER CURIAM.

In this dissolution proceeding, husband raises five points on appeal. Among other things, he contends the trial court erred in denying his oral motion for continuance and granting custody of their child to wife.
